ok i’m not sure if this is a thing in the all around world bc I haven’t shown aqha in over 15 yrs, BUT I veryyyyyy strongly believe we need an amended system for nonpros in the reining. bc how are you gonna tell me that there are people who’ve trained and sold $1mil+ worth of horses by themselves.. but are able to compete in the nonpro? it’s largely only possible if they’re financially secure enough to do this without needing their own training program or teaching lessons to bring in income. and it’s truly no shade to any of these people - if I could do that too then you bet I would! but the system itself needs some reshaping imo. just feels silly that someone who maybe teaches lessons here and there to earn a little extra cash is in violation of their nonpro standing when training and selling your own horses does not disqualify you as a nonpro. I could very well be missing something but that’s my understanding at least!

I would move yearling classes to 2 years olds (longe line/in hand) and 2 year old classes to 3 year olds (1st year riding). Too many horses are pushed too young, and there is no longevity for them. I would love to see stats on how many horses that show at 2 are still showing when they are 6+.
